Does anyone know EXACTLY which files control which version's server-list appears in "join game"?

2) it is hard-coded into Soldat.  The only way you can do it is by editing the binary which is
-illegal
- hard, since the thing you search for to replace probably has hundreds of occurences within Soldat, if not more.

The answer: you can't.  You can write a third-party program to query the lobby directly (once I finish the documentation on the public lobby interfaces), or you can look at http://rr.soldat.pl

The in-game lobby only shows the servers that match your version of Soldat because you won't be able to play on any servers that don't match your version anyway.
